RECOMMENDED ACTION: Approve and authorize the Health Services Director or his designee (Milt Camhi) •' to execute on behalf of the County, Non-Physician Services Contract #27-123 with Phyllis Potter, LCSW, for the period from January 1, 1996 through December 31, 1996, to be paid in accordance with the rates set forth in the agreement, for the provision of professional outpatient psychotherapy services. II. FINANCIAL IMPACT: This Contract is funded by Contra Costa Health Plan member premiums. Costs depend upon utilization. As appropriate, patients and/or third party payors will be billed for services. III. REASONS FOR RECOMMENDATIONS/BACKGROUND: The Contra Costa Health Plan (CCHP) has an obligation to provide professional outpatient psychotherapy services for CCHP members with mental health therapy services as a covered benefit. This population includes Medi-Cal, Medicare and Commercial members enrolled in the Health Plan. A recent Request for Proposal (RFP) was used to identify therapists who have the experience, special skills and administrative resources to participate in the CCHP Mental Health Provider Network. Standard form contracts are necessary to formalize the relationship between CCHP and the providers identified in the RFP process. Approval of Non-Physician Services Contract #27-123 will allow this Contractor to provide professional outpatient psychotherapy services through December 31, 1996.
